We recently got a new audioconsole a Digidesign Sc48. While testing the consoles firewire connections I recognized that the Venue does appear in the Audio-Midi connection menue. So I started Qlab an could get the console working with it. The Firewire connectors are normaly used for a Protools system described here:

Seamless Pro Tools Integration
SC48 features a built-in Pro Tools LE FireWire interface, making it easy to connect a computer (sold separately) running Pro Tools LE software (included with SC48) to record and archive live performances or for audio playback. With VENUE and Pro Tools®, you can also perform Virtual Soundcheck — a timesaving process that lets you play tracks recorded from a previous live performance, and fine-tune your mix settings before an actual show or rehearsal without requiring the band or performers to be there.

The console is defintly the easiest way to get a high quality Qlab environment working as you need only a MacLaptop and the console and you can control 18 mono channels.

If someone is interested download the Venue standalone software for the SC48  unfortunatly only running under windows. In the patchbay you can define the Qlab (protools) input and you are fine. Especially if you know the software provided by Yamaha the import and export features of shows and the so called snapshots are impressing. (in the manual chapter 21 page 167 ) The above standalone software provides full functionality except the plugin section. This allows to prebuild a complete setup without the console and to have time for other things.

Tested under 10.5.8 and the latest qlab Version and the Digidesign Protools LE 8.03 (as the Digidesign CoreAudio driver is used)
